The Indian diaspora, comprising over 32 million individuals across the globe, serves as a significant instrument of India’s soft power. This paper explores how the diaspora promotes India’s cultural, economic, and diplomatic influence through activities such as cultural festivals, economic remittances, and advocacy in host countries.
